Narsak Peak
Narsak Peak is a mountain in Kujalleq, Greenland and has an elevation of 245 metres. Narsak Peak is situated nearby to the hamlet Dyrnæs.Places of Interest

Narsaq Heliport
Helipad
Photo: Algkalv,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Narsaq Heliport is a heliport in the northwestern part of Narsaq, a town in the Kujalleq municipality, in southern Greenland. The route of the Arctic Umiaq Line no longer extends to Narsarsuaq during summer, hence the need for Europe-bound passengers to transfer in Narsaq Heliport, with several daily departures to Narsarsuaq. Narsaq Heliport is situated 3 km west of Narsak Peak.

Dyrnæs
Hamlet
Dyrnæs was a Norse settlement in Eastern Settlement in Greenland. It was located to the north of modern-day Narsaq. Dyrnæs is situated 4 km north of Narsak Peak.
